Transaction 914c396704dc53a4c300f41ee1f7b3ccd6a3a29803ecfa564961fe18eef16407
1 Input
1 Output
-
914c396704dc53a4c300f41ee1f7b3ccd6a3a29803ecfa564961fe18eef16407:0
- value
- 2485876
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2b8c4bec547c2490f5aec234778dcbd6901d8b30 OP_EQUAL
- address
- 35fH3maSGiB3EuChAZwAvjbB3Ah6dmnGEa